Job Title: Executive Driver

Location: Lekki Phase 1, Lagos
Employment Type: Full-time

Job Background

  • We are looking for a well-experienced and presentable driver.
  • As the driver, you are to plan and follow an efficient route for each delivery to maximize time.
  • You will be responsible for the upkeep and maintenance of the vehicle and observe every road safety measure.

Key Duties

  • Safely operate and maintain vehicles in compliance with local and international traffic regulations.
  • Transport Executivesto and from specified locations in a timely and efficient manner.
  • Perform vehicle inspections and basic maintenance, reporting any issues promptly.
  • Plan and follow the most efficient routes for each trip to ensure on-time arrival.
  • Provide a high level of professionalism when interacting with Executivesand colleagues.
  • Keep accurate records of mileage, fuel consumption, and vehicle maintenance.
  • Adhere to safety protocols and emergency procedures, including first aid and crisis response.
  • Maintain cleanliness and orderliness of vehicles.
  • Ensure that all required vehicle documents, such as licenses, insurance, and registration, are up to date and valid.
  • Report any accidents, injuries, or traffic violations and cooperate the management and law enforcement authorities.
  • Follow internal agreed policies and guidelines on vehicle use and code of conduct.
  • Stay updated on local traffic and road conditions that may affect movement schedules and plans.
  • Ensure vehicle insurance and registration is updated according to schedule.
  • Furnish management or representatives of vehicle maintenance and charge in spare parts.

Key Job Requirements

  • Candidates should possess a High School Diploma
  • Minimum of 5years of driving experience with a good driving record.
  • The job location is on the Island. Our Ideal candidate should reside on the Island.
  • Working hours Monday - Saturday, 2 times a month for Sunday
  • Excellent driving skills
  • Valid driver’s license.
  • Good knowledge of roads within Lagos and Nigeria.
  • Willing to work long and irregular hours, and on public holidays as required
  • Understanding of transportation law is an essential
  • Good traffic judgment
  • Good knowledge of car mechanics
  • Flexible, effective teamwork and interpersonal skills
  • Good communication skills
  • Good in communicating in English, and any other Local Language.
